Binance Alpha Points 2025: Structure and Strategic Implications

Binance's Alpha Points system operates on a rolling 15-day rule, ensuring that only recent activity contributes to a user's eligibility. This creates a fast-paced environment where consistent engagement is non-negotiable. The recent BSC 4x promotion—which multiplies volume from BSC-chain limit buy orders by four—has amplified the urgency to act swiftly. For instance, a user trading $100 worth of Alpha tokens on BSC now earns the equivalent of $400 in point-qualifying activity.

Airdrop thresholds, however, are equally volatile. Projects like Yala (YALA) and Aspecta (ASP) have set Phase 1 access at 238–225 points, with thresholds dropping by 10 points hourly if rewards remain undistributed. This dynamic pricing model rewards early participation but demands precise timing. Investors must balance the risk of overcommitting to speculative tokens against the potential for outsized gains.

Wallet Comparison: Security, BSC Compatibility, and Airdrop Efficiency

Choosing the right wallet is critical for managing Alpha Points and claiming airdrops. Three wallets stand out in 2025:

  1. Binance Wallet
  2. Strengths: Deep integration with Binance's ecosystem, low BSC transaction fees, and real-time access to airdrop announcements. Ideal for users already active on Binance.
  3. Use Case: Seamless execution of BSC-based trades and airdrop claims, with biometric security for asset protection.

  4. Best Wallet

  5. Strengths: Non-custodial control, built-in DEX aggregator for liquidity optimization, and real-time market alerts. Suited for traders prioritizing autonomy.
  6. Use Case: Efficient swapping of airdropped tokens post-claim, with minimal slippage due to DEX integration.

  7. Bybit Wallet

  8. Strengths: Multi-chain support (BSC, , Polygon) and fiat on-ramps for quick conversions. However, its 2025 security incident necessitates cautious use.
  9. Use Case: Flexibility for cross-chain airdrop participation, though users must prioritize strong private key management.

For most Alpha Points participants, Binance Wallet remains the default due to its ecosystem synergy. However, Best Wallet offers a compelling alternative for those seeking non-custodial security without sacrificing functionality.
